> Something for the inhibition experts out there:
>> I'm looking for a drug that will prevent or at least reduce the
> desensitization of GABA-A receptors. Basically a GABAeric version of
> cyclothiazide.
Surely you'd have to find a way to sterically hinder the action of
whatever is desensitising the receptors? What's desensitising them?
I can tell you that allopregnanolone is a potent endogenous potentiator
of the GABA-A receptor, but it would be a pain to deliver in a
controlled way - it's a steroid so you usually have to use very sticky
vehicle.
